博客 轻量化数据中台的技术实现与高效构建方法

轻量化数据中台的技术实现与高效构建方法

   数栈君   发表于 2026-01-20 16:51  48  0

在数字化转型的浪潮中,数据中台已成为企业实现数据驱动决策的核心基础设施。然而,随着企业对实时性、灵活性和高效性的要求不断提高,传统的 heavyweight 数据中台逐渐暴露出架构复杂、部署困难、成本高昂等问题。轻量化数据中台(Lightweight Data Middle Platform)作为一种新兴的技术架构,以其简洁、高效和灵活的特点,正在成为企业数字化转型的首选方案。本文将深入探讨轻量化数据中台的技术实现与高效构建方法,为企业提供实用的指导。


一、轻量化数据中台的核心技术

轻量化数据中台的核心在于“轻量化”,这意味着它在功能上不妥协,但在架构设计和实现方式上更加注重简洁性和高效性。以下是轻量化数据中台的几个关键技术特点:

1. 微服务架构

传统的数据中台通常采用单体架构,导致系统耦合度高、扩展性差。而轻量化数据中台基于微服务架构,将功能模块化,每个服务独立运行,互不影响。这种架构不仅提高了系统的可扩展性,还降低了维护成本。

  • 模块化设计:数据采集、数据处理、数据存储、数据可视化等模块可以独立开发和部署。
  • 高可用性:单个服务故障不会导致整个系统崩溃,提升了系统的稳定性。

2. 容器化部署

容器化技术(如 Docker)是轻量化数据中台实现高效部署的关键。通过容器化,数据中台可以在不同的环境中快速部署和扩展,满足企业对弹性计算的需求。

  • 快速启动:容器启动时间短,可以在几秒内完成部署。
  • 资源利用率高:容器共享操作系统内核,减少了资源浪费。

3. Serverless 技术

Serverless(无服务器计算)是一种新兴的技术,能够进一步简化数据中台的运维复杂度。通过 Serverless,企业可以按需使用计算资源,无需关心底层基础设施。

  • 按需扩展:在数据处理高峰期,系统可以自动扩展计算资源;高峰期过后,资源自动释放。
  • 降低运维成本:Serverless 服务提供商负责基础设施的运维,企业只需关注业务逻辑。

4. 实时数据处理

轻量化数据中台通常采用流处理技术(如 Apache Flink),实现实时数据的高效处理和分析。

  • 低延迟:流处理技术可以在数据生成的瞬间完成处理,满足企业对实时性的要求。
  • 高吞吐量:能够处理大规模数据流,适用于 IoT、实时监控等场景。

5. 轻量化数据建模

数据建模是数据中台的核心功能之一。轻量化数据中台通过简化数据建模过程,降低了技术门槛,使业务人员也能参与数据建模。

  • 可视化建模:通过图形化界面,用户可以快速完成数据建模,无需编写复杂代码。
  • 动态调整:模型可以根据业务需求快速调整,无需重新部署整个系统。

二、轻量化数据中台的高效构建方法

构建一个高效的轻量化数据中台需要从需求分析、技术选型到系统部署的全生命周期进行规划。以下是具体的构建方法:

1. 需求分析与规划

在构建轻量化数据中台之前,企业需要明确自身的业务需求和技术目标。

  • 业务需求分析:了解企业的核心业务场景,确定数据中台需要支持的功能模块(如数据采集、处理、分析、可视化等)。
  • 技术目标设定:明确技术架构、性能指标、安全性要求等。

2. 模块化设计

基于微服务架构,将数据中台的功能模块化设计。

  • 数据采集模块:负责从多种数据源(如数据库、API、物联网设备等)采集数据。
  • 数据处理模块:对采集到的数据进行清洗、转换和计算。
  • 数据存储模块:选择合适的存储方案(如关系型数据库、NoSQL 数据库、大数据平台等)。
  • 数据可视化模块:通过可视化工具(如 Tableau、Power BI 等)将数据呈现给用户。

3. 技术选型

选择适合企业需求的技术栈。

  • 编程语言:根据开发团队的熟悉程度选择 Python、Java、JavaScript 等。
  • 框架与工具:选择适合微服务架构的框架(如 Spring Cloud、Django 等)和容器化工具(如 Docker、Kubernetes 等)。
  • 云服务:选择适合的云服务提供商(如 AWS、阿里云、腾讯云等)。

4. 快速开发与迭代

轻量化数据中台的开发周期短,支持快速迭代。

  • 敏捷开发:采用敏捷开发模式,快速交付功能模块。
  • 持续集成与持续部署(CI/CD):通过自动化工具实现代码的持续集成和持续部署,确保代码质量。

5. 系统优化与监控

在系统上线后,需要进行持续的优化和监控。

  • 性能优化:通过 profiling 工具分析系统性能瓶颈,进行针对性优化。
  • 系统监控:使用监控工具(如 Prometheus、Grafana 等)实时监控系统运行状态,及时发现和解决问题。

三、轻量化数据中台的应用场景

轻量化数据中台凭借其高效、灵活的特点,已经在多个领域得到了广泛应用。

1. 智能制造

在智能制造领域,轻量化数据中台可以实现实时生产监控、设备状态分析和生产优化。

  • 生产监控:通过物联网设备采集生产数据,实时监控生产线运行状态。
  • 设备预测性维护:通过机器学习算法预测设备故障,提前进行维护。

2. 智慧城市

在智慧城市领域,轻量化数据中台可以支持交通管理、环境监测和公共安全。

  • 交通管理:通过实时数据分析,优化交通信号灯控制,缓解交通拥堵。
  • 环境监测:通过传感器数据,实时监测空气质量、水质等环境指标。

3. 零售与电商

在零售与电商领域,轻量化数据中台可以支持客户行为分析、销售预测和库存管理。

  • 客户行为分析:通过分析客户行为数据,优化营销策略。
  • 销售预测:通过历史销售数据和市场趋势,预测未来销售情况。

四、轻量化数据中台的未来发展趋势

随着技术的不断进步,轻量化数据中台的发展方向也在不断演变。

1. 边缘计算

边缘计算是一种将计算能力推向数据源端的技术,能够进一步降低数据传输延迟。

  • 本地数据处理:通过边缘计算,数据可以在生成端完成处理,减少对云端的依赖。
  • 低带宽场景:在带宽受限的场景下,边缘计算可以显著提升数据处理效率。

2. AI 驱动

人工智能(AI)技术的快速发展,为轻量化数据中台带来了新的可能性。

  • 自动化数据处理:通过 AI 技术实现数据的自动清洗、建模和分析。
  • 智能决策支持:通过 AI 模型提供决策支持,帮助企业做出更明智的业务决策。

3. 与数字孪生的结合

数字孪生(Digital Twin)是一种通过数字模型反映物理世界的技术,与轻量化数据中台的结合将为企业提供更直观的决策支持。

  • 实时模拟:通过数字孪生技术,企业可以实时模拟生产过程、设备运行状态等。
  • 虚实结合:通过数字孪生与物理世界的结合,实现更高效的资源优化。

五、结语

轻量化数据中台以其简洁、高效和灵活的特点,正在成为企业数字化转型的重要推动力。通过采用微服务架构、容器化部署、Serverless 技术等先进方法,企业可以快速构建一个高效、可靠的轻量化数据中台。同时,随着边缘计算、AI 驱动和数字孪生等技术的不断发展,轻量化数据中台的应用场景和功能也将进一步扩展。

如果您对轻量化数据中台感兴趣,可以申请试用相关产品,了解更多具体信息。申请试用


通过本文的介绍,相信您已经对轻量化数据中台的技术实现与高效构建方法有了更深入的了解。希望这些内容能够为您的企业数字化转型提供有价值的参考!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料